Output 3d85d2a9fa4bacad854d6fa916be1d0f529795dd9123c4064801f463371edd89:3

value
678438152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d77a0cd7d10f73d54e46def33b6766441ae91e4e OP_EQUALVERIFY OP_CHECKSIG
address
1LeLVSQ48o7BeBJRaEhaJrg4SuWp5GNr5y
transaction
3d85d2a9fa4bacad854d6fa916be1d0f529795dd9123c4064801f463371edd89
confirmations
561296
spent
true